A free rabies vaccination clinic will be available to the public on Friday, Nov. 14, from 4:00 pm – 6:00 pm at 41 York St. Auburn, NY. The clinic will be hosted by the Cayuga County Health Department and the Finger Lakes SPCA of Central New York.
Dogs, cats, or ferrets that are at least four months of age are welcome. Dogs must be leashed and muzzled if necessary. Cats and ferrets must be in carriers, with one animal per carrier.
To receive a three-year Rabies Vaccine, proof of prior vaccination must be presented. Rabies tags are not acceptable proof. Ferrets will receive one-year certificates.
While the Cayuga County Health Department has stated that pre-registration is not required to bring animals in for vaccination, it is preferred. For more information and to pre-register, contact the Finger Lakes SPCA at (315)253-5841 or pre-register online.
